William Herron (Herring) Sr. B. abt 1755 in Augusta Co. VA

I am looking for decendents of my GG grandfather Reuben L. Herrin born 1835 in Webster(Hopkins)Co.KY married Zerelda McMullins. Both are buried in Dixon, KY.

Reuben's father was William S. Herrin Jr born 1792 in PA and married in Hopkins County KY on 1-8-1820
#1-Martha"Patsy P.Thomasson born 1791 in VA
children: Wm. Thomas 3-24-1822
John L. 1827
Reuben 1834 (my GG grandfather)
Frances C. 1837
David C. 1839
Matthew 1840
Martha "Patsy"
Mary
Elizabeth W."Betsy"
#2 marriage to Piety K. Chandler b. 1813 in NC. married
5-14-1843 in Hopkins Co,KY.
Children:
Margaret S. 1848
Susan E. 1849
Garlan 1852
Samuel 1860
Rubin 1869

Back to William S. Herrin Jr:
His father was Wm.Herron(Herring)Sr.born 1755 in Augusta Co.VA, married Mary Herron b. 1771 in NC
children: William S. Herrin Jr. 1792 in PA
Reubin Herrin
James Herron
Eleanor Herron
George Herron

William SR was frequently found in the "History of Rockingham County" VA. A 26 page account of the establishment of the county declared by Gov. Patrick Henry. He worked side by side with Benjamin Harrison to construct the necessary judicial foundation for the county. Great reading!!! There is a mention of Alexander Herring, Bethewell Herring and I know there was a Nelso Herring in another Augusta document.
Apparently William Sr. went to Pennsylvania as per the birth if William Jr. then I loose him until they show up in the 1860 census of Webster County KY.
